I’m Gutted, But my Focus is on Supporting Boys, Says Liverpool’s Adam Lallana After Getting Ruled Out For 3 Months

Liverpool Midfielder Lallana will miss the first three months of the season due to thigh injury

Updated: August 6, 2017, 5:29 PM IST

Liverpool midfielder Adam Lallana will miss the first three months of the season, delivering a major setback to the Merseyside club as they will without their playmaker for the beginning of the Premier League campaign, as well as the two-legged Champions League play-off against Hoffenheim.

However, despite being miserable at his long layoff, Lallana has offered encouraging words to Liverpool, as in one of his Instagram post, the 29-year-old stated that he is determined to get back as quickly as possible.

Given the seriousness of his injury, Lallana will also miss England’s next two World Cup qualifiers against Malta and Slovenia at the beginning of September and the dark prognosis for Liverpool indicates he will miss the October round of internationals too.

It now looks unlikely that Lallana will feature again for Liverpool before November, but he’ll be keen to make himself available for what promises to be an exciting second half of the campaign.
